What Is Ceramic Window Tinting?
Ceramic window tint is a premium automotive window film made with non-metallic nano-ceramic particles. Unlike standard dyed film, ceramic tint blocks infrared heat without darkening visibility excessively.
Drivers across Orlando, Winter Park, Alafaya, and Kissimmee choose ceramic tint because it performs well in Florida’s year-round sun exposure and humidity.
The film is engineered to:
- Block UV rays
- Reduce cabin heat
- Improve driving comfort
- Protect interiors
- Reduce glare
- Maintain electronic connectivity
Unlike metallic tint, ceramic film does not disrupt:
- GPS systems
- Bluetooth
- Cell phone signals
- Keyless entry systems
- Satellite radio
That makes it one of the most advanced auto tinting solutions available today.

How Does Ceramic Window Tint Work?
Ceramic tint uses microscopic ceramic particles embedded in the film layer. These particles absorb and reflect infrared heat while allowing visible light transmission.
Unlike older tint technologies, ceramic film does not rely on dyes or metals.
Ceramic Film Performance Benefits
| Performance Area | Ceramic Tint Performance |
|---|---|
| Infrared Heat Blocking | Excellent |
| UV Rejection | Up to 99% |
| Interior Protection | High |
| Signal Blocking | None |
| Optical Clarity | High |
| Night Visibility | Better than dyed tint |
The technology is designed to reduce solar heat without making the vehicle excessively dark.

Is Ceramic Tint Better Than Dyed or Metallic Tint?
Ceramic vs Dyed vs Metallic Window Tint
| Feature | Ceramic | Metallic | Dyed |
|---|---|---|---|
| Heat Rejection | Excellent | Good | Moderate |
| UV Blocking | Excellent | Good | Moderate |
| Signal Interference | None | Yes | None |
| Fade Resistance | Excellent | Good | Low |
| Appearance | Premium | Reflective | Basic |
| Lifespan | 10+ Years | 5–10 Years | 2–5 Years |
Ceramic tint generally costs more upfront, but many Orlando drivers prefer it because of its performance and longevity.
Is Ceramic Window Tint Legal in Florida?
Florida window tint laws regulate Visible Light Transmission (VLT) percentages for vehicles.
Florida Tint Law Overview
| Vehicle Area | Legal VLT |
|---|---|
| Front Side Windows | 28% |
| Rear Side Windows | 15% |
| Rear Window | 15% |
Professional Orlando tint shops usually help customers choose legal tint percentages that still provide strong heat rejection.
Drivers should avoid illegal tint darkness because violations can result in citations.

What Is the Ceramic Tint Installation Process?
Professional installation improves both appearance and longevity.
Typical Ceramic Tint Installation Steps
- Vehicle windows are deep-cleaned
- Film patterns are precision-cut
- Glass surfaces are prepped
- Ceramic film is installed carefully
- Air bubbles and moisture are removed
- Heat shrinking ensures proper fitment
- Final inspection is completed
Most Orlando installations take between 2 and 4 hours, depending on vehicle size.
